Wonderful Everyday Down the Rabbit-Hole (2017)

2/37
0
0
Flag this vote item as:
Itunes Ad Thumbnail
...

A celebrated visual novel, *Wonderful Everyday* originally garnered acclaim by winning Best Story at the 2010 Moe Game Awards. This beloved title, penned by SCA-DI and brought to life with art by Kagome, Motoyone, Suzuri, and karory, features intricate multiple routes to explore. For its international release, the visuals have been enhanced to a higher resolution, maintaining the original aspect ratio to provide a more immersive and compelling journey through this masterpiece. The "Down the Rabbit-Hole" scenario within *Wonderful Everyday* presents a poignant narrative exploring the connection between the sky and the world. Protagonist Minakami Yuki's encounter with a falling stuffed toy initiates a quest into ancient town rituals, an offering to the sky in hopes of returning to it. This tale intertwines themes of celestial bodies like Vega, Altair, and Deneb, forming the "heavenly triangle," with the destinies of characters like Takashima Zakuro and the Wakatsuki sisters as they search for a nexus where the terrestrial and celestial realms converge.
